Warning Signs You Need Foundation Leak Water Removal

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. That’s why it’s essential to catch these signs early and address them quickly. Here are some common warning signs you need foundation leak water removal: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show hidden water damage or mold growth. If you notice musty smells in your basement or crawl space, it’s time to call us.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Discoloration or staining on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any unusual stains, don’t wait – call us today.

Cracks in Your Foundation or Walls

Cracks in your foundation or walls can be a sign of structural damage or water pressure. If you notice any cracks, it’s essential to address them quickly to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or uneven settlement. If you notice any unusual flooring issues, call us today.

High Water Bills

Unusually high water bills can be a sign of a hidden leak. If you notice any unusual increases in your water bills, it’s time to investigate further.

Foundation Leak Water Removal Cost in Elloree, SC

The cost of foundation leak water removal in Elloree, SC can vary widely dep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and other local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of leak, and equipment needed.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ed, and duration of drying process.
Repair and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, materials needed, and labor costs.
Inspection and Assessment $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ed, and complexity of inspection.
Mold Remediation $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of mold, and equipment needed.
Equipment Rental $500 – $2,000 Duration of rental, equipment type, and rental fees.

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. We’ll provide a free, on-site assessment to find out the exact cost of our services.
